Archパッケージストアへのアクセスを制限する方法は?

Archパッケージストアへのアクセスを制限する方法は?

さまざまな独自ライセンスの理由により、広く共有できないパッケージを含むArch Linux用のカスタムパッケージストアを作成しました。理想的には、インターネット経由でリポジトリを使用できるようにしたいのですが、パスワード(またはキー)に基づいてアクセスを制限したいと思います。いくつかの指示が見つかりました。ダーバンリポジトリへのアクセスを制限しながら、通常のapt動作を可能にする様々な方法が提供される。

これアーチスウィキ文書化は非常に弱いです。使用可能なArch用のパスワード(公開/秘密鍵)保護リポジトリを作成する方法はありますかpacman?ユーザーが自分のコンピュータを更新する前にパッケージストアをインストールする必要がないようにしたいと思います。私はpacmanすべてを大事にしたかったです。ユーザーがアップグレードするためにパスワードを入力する必要があります。

ベストアンサー1

私の考えに最適な方法は、設定を管理するためにパックマンの周りにスクリプト(シェルスクリプトなど)をラップすることです。

あなたの質問にいくつかの詳細がありませんが、あなたのリポジトリはインターネットからアクセスできず、ローカルLANからのみアクセスできると仮定します。しかし、ソフトウェアはユーザーごとにライセンスされているので(サイト全体ではありません)、パッケージを制限するには何が必要ですか?他のユーザーがインストールできます。

おすすめ記事